We already knew the context of the incident and that the incident occurred while Renner was trying to help a family member. Now the sheriff’s report reveals it it is his nephewthat he was trying to pull his car out of the snow, the one that was about to be run over by the 4,500-pound snow blower.

The report is explicit and explains in detail how the accidents occurred: “When Renner tried to stop or swerve the car, to avoid injuring his nephew, the track dragged him under the vehicle and he was run over”. The document also reveals the moments after the accident, moments in which the Renners had severe breathing difficulties: “He lay on the ground and concentrated on his breathing as his nephew and others tried to help him until medical personnel arrived on the scene.”. Luckily his nephew had no regrets no physical damage.

The Washoe County Sheriff’s Office conducts their respective investigations and reports. Said report points to the possibility that Renner’s accident was a human error: “The snowthrower started to slide, forcing Renner to get off the vehicle without applying the emergency brake. […] Although the machine had some mechanical issues, based on our inspection, it is believed that the parking brake would have prevented the plow from moving forward.”says the file.

human and mechanical errors

The revealed report contemplates the possibility that this incident it could have been avoided. The machine has a parking brake, which could have averted the catastrophe that cost Renner more than two weeks in the hospital, two surgeries, one ICU stay and 32 broken bones. Despite the fact that the sheriff’s report states that this event could have been avoided, he also acknowledges that the machinery has a faulty light that shows whether or not the brake is on.
